void max7456ReInit(void)
{
    uint8_t srdata = 0;
    static bool firstInit = true;

    __spiBusTransactionBegin(busdev);

    switch (videoSignalCfg) {
    case VIDEO_SYSTEM_PAL:
        videoSignalReg = VIDEO_MODE_PAL | OSD_ENABLE;
        break;

    case VIDEO_SYSTEM_NTSC:
        videoSignalReg = VIDEO_MODE_NTSC | OSD_ENABLE;
        break;

    case VIDEO_SYSTEM_AUTO:
        srdata = max7456Send(MAX7456ADD_STAT, 0x00);

        if (VIN_IS_NTSC(srdata)) {
            videoSignalReg = VIDEO_MODE_NTSC | OSD_ENABLE;
        } else if (VIN_IS_PAL(srdata)) {
            videoSignalReg = VIDEO_MODE_PAL | OSD_ENABLE;
        } else {
            // No valid input signal, fallback to default (XXX NTSC for now)
            videoSignalReg = VIDEO_MODE_NTSC | OSD_ENABLE;
        }
        break;
    }

    if (videoSignalReg & VIDEO_MODE_PAL) { //PAL
        maxScreenSize = VIDEO_BUFFER_CHARS_PAL;
    } else {              // NTSC
        maxScreenSize = VIDEO_BUFFER_CHARS_NTSC;
    }

    // Set all rows to same charactor black/white level
    max7456Brightness(0, 2);
    // Re-enable MAX7456 (last function call disables it)
    __spiBusTransactionBegin(busdev);

    // Make sure the Max7456 is enabled
    max7456Send(MAX7456ADD_VM0, videoSignalReg);
    max7456Send(MAX7456ADD_HOS, hosRegValue);
    max7456Send(MAX7456ADD_VOS, vosRegValue);

    max7456Send(MAX7456ADD_DMM, displayMemoryModeReg | CLEAR_DISPLAY);
    __spiBusTransactionEnd(busdev);

    // Clear shadow to force redraw all screen in non-dma mode.
    memset(shadowBuffer, 0, maxScreenSize);
    if (firstInit) {
        max7456DrawScreenSlow();
        firstInit = false;
    }
}

void max7456ReInitIfRequired(void)
{
    static uint32_t lastSigCheckMs = 0;
    static uint32_t videoDetectTimeMs = 0;
    static uint16_t reInitCount = 0;

    __spiBusTransactionBegin(busdev);
    const uint8_t stallCheck = max7456Send(MAX7456ADD_VM0|MAX7456ADD_READ, 0x00);
    __spiBusTransactionEnd(busdev);

    const timeMs_t nowMs = millis();

    if (stallCheck != videoSignalReg) {
        max7456ReInit();
    } else if ((videoSignalCfg == VIDEO_SYSTEM_AUTO)
              && ((nowMs - lastSigCheckMs) > MAX7456_SIGNAL_CHECK_INTERVAL_MS)) {

        // Adjust output format based on the current input format.

        __spiBusTransactionBegin(busdev);
        const uint8_t videoSense = max7456Send(MAX7456ADD_STAT, 0x00);
        __spiBusTransactionEnd(busdev);

        DEBUG_SET(DEBUG_MAX7456_SIGNAL, DEBUG_MAX7456_SIGNAL_MODEREG, videoSignalReg & VIDEO_MODE_MASK);
        DEBUG_SET(DEBUG_MAX7456_SIGNAL, DEBUG_MAX7456_SIGNAL_SENSE, videoSense & 0x7);
        DEBUG_SET(DEBUG_MAX7456_SIGNAL, DEBUG_MAX7456_SIGNAL_ROWS, max7456GetRowsCount());

        if (videoSense & STAT_LOS) {
            videoDetectTimeMs = 0;
        } else {
            if ((VIN_IS_PAL(videoSense) && VIDEO_MODE_IS_NTSC(videoSignalReg))
              || (VIN_IS_NTSC_alt(videoSense) && VIDEO_MODE_IS_PAL(videoSignalReg))) {
                if (videoDetectTimeMs) {
                    if (millis() - videoDetectTimeMs > VIDEO_SIGNAL_DEBOUNCE_MS) {
                        max7456ReInit();
                        DEBUG_SET(DEBUG_MAX7456_SIGNAL, DEBUG_MAX7456_SIGNAL_REINIT, ++reInitCount);
                    }
                } else {
                    // Wait for signal to stabilize
                    videoDetectTimeMs = millis();
                }
            }
        }

        lastSigCheckMs = nowMs;
    }

    //------------   end of (re)init-------------------------------------
}
